A very odd coincidence happened on Monday evening.

I’ve been producing and presenting a weekly Celtic music show on the NPR station in Johnson City Tennessee for nearly twenty years now (WETS.fm). It’s called ‘Celtic Clanjamphry’ and initially airs on their main FM and HD1 channel on Sunday evenings and then repeats on their HD2 channel on Mondays and Saturdays. It then goes out on WEHC.fm here in Virginia on the following Sunday. Because I record them ahead of time with the enormous help of my engineer Dirk, I’m never quite sure which episode is airing any particular week. I got a message on Monday morning from a listener and so I checked the Monday evening repeat to check which one was going out.

A few months ago Wendy started working part-time for West Virginia Public Radio as a producer and presenter for their show called ‘Inside Appalachia’ which goes out there on Sunday mornings and is then re-broadcast on a whole host of other NPR stations from Ohio to Georgia, and Kentucky to North Carolina. One of the stations that takes it is – yes – WETS.fm in Johnson City!

Last week her first program came 2nd in Best Feature at the AP Virginias Broadcasting awards, out of more than 400 entries from all over Virginia and West Virginia which was very exciting! Her latest story is all about a 10 year search for the maker of hand thrown clay mugs. It’s quite a moving story!

On Monday past, at 8pm I went to the WETS website to check which of my programs was being broadcast on HD2. Lo and behold, to my surprise they were airing ‘Inside Appalachia’ on their fm/HD1 channel at exactly the same time, and it was Wendy’s mug story! So we were both on the same station at the same time!

So I went to Wendy and told her this and with a big grin on her face she said, “Hmm, which one shall we listen to?”

I’m a smart husband…..
